Hi,
I got my first RX-7 today as a project for the summer.
The only thing is I have never seen an exhaust quite like the one on this car.
It has the normal regular pipes you would expect to find from front to back,
The bit I dont understand is the 2 other pipes which are part of the exhaust system
One of them seems to be ok and is connected at both ends the other is only conneceted at the engine end and seems to run along down the car and exits near the nsr wheel and makes loads of noise im sure this should connect back to the main exhaust somewhere but where???
does anyone have a diagram they could send me or explain it to me PLEASE
PLEASE PLEASE help

I assume it's a turbo based on your location. does it by any chance make a whoooosh sound every so often?
I wanna say it's a divorced Downpipe with the wastegate vented to the atmosphere. Pictures, drawings and any more details would yield more accurate answers/guesses.
my second guess is that it's the Split air pipe ( I know the NA's have them but I can't recall if my Turbo had it also, it's been years since I've had stock exhaust)

One of the pipes is the "split air pipe." This connects from the cat to the intake manifold and on s4's has another tube that that splits off and feeds the aux port activators.
On the other one, I have no idea. Where on the engine does it connect to?
Again, pics would really help if possible.
